A blend of Slovak, Hungarian, and German influences has created a European city unlike any other in Bratislava’s compact medieval Old Town. On this walking tour through Slovakia’s capital, you’ll discover how this strategic location at the crossroads of ancient trade routes shaped its remarkable history.
Starting at Rybné Square, you’ll find out how the city evolved from a Roman settlement to a medieval trading post, before becoming an imperial capital and finally a modern European center. You’ll hear how Bratislava served as the coronation city for Hungarian kings when Budapest was occupied by Ottoman forces.
As you make your way to the historical Michael’s Bridge where our tour ends, you’ll learn why Bratislava was the chosen site for the signing of the Peace of Pressburg that helped bring the Holy Roman Empire to an end.
By the end of this Bratislava walking tour, you’ll have discovered a city where three cultures and 2,000 years of fascinating history converge.
